WebJun 29, 2024 · While most C. diff infections are treated effectively with standard antibiotic therapy, the infection does have a significant rate of recurrence. As stated by the NIH US National Library of Medicine, 20 to 30% of those afflicted experience recurrent or persistent symptoms, often at increasing rates. WebNov 22, 2024 · C. difficile infection (CDI) is one of the most common health care-associated infections and a significant cause of morbidity and mortality, especially among older adult hospitalized patients. The clinical manifestations and diagnosis of CDI will be reviewed here. The treatment, epidemiology, and prevention of CDI are discussed separately. WebAccording to the Centers for Disease Control and Prevention (CDC), Each year, more than 2 million people in the United States get infections from germs that are resistant to antibiotics– and at least 23,000 people die as a result. C. difficile infections—which can occur after using antibiotics—kill at least another 15,000 Americans a year. WebAug 27, 2024 · For recurrent or stubborn C. difficile infections, fecal microbiota transplant (FMT) has been performed at Mayo Clinic with an overall high success rate. FMT therapy involves infusing healthy donor stools into people with C. difficile infections. Mayo Clinic performs extensive testing of donors and recipients before performing the procedure and ...
